Possible Causes of Leaky Faucets & Fixtures

Leaking faucets and fixtures often stem from worn-out or damaged parts inside the valve or cartridge. Over time, the seals, washers, and O-rings can deteriorate due to regular usage, causing constant dripping. Hard water deposits can also build up inside the fixture, corroding the internal components and leading to leaks. Additionally, improper installation or a sudden water pressure surge can strain fixtures, making them prone to leaks.

Other common causes include aging plumbing fixtures that have simply reached the end of their lifespan. Stress from frequent usage or rough handling can also weaken connections and cause leaks. Sometimes, underlying pipe issues or sediment buildup in the water supply can create pressure problems that manifest as leaks at the fixtures. Identifying the root cause is key to effective repair and preventing future problems.

What are the signs of a hidden leak behind fixtures?

Signs include unexplained increases in water bills, musty odors, water stains on walls or ceilings, and mold growth. If you notice any of these, contact our experts for a thorough inspection and leak detection.
